Sector comparison and peer dynamics
Within the U.S. drug retail space, Walgreens competes primarily with CVS Health and, increasingly, big-box and online players that offer pharmacy and health services. This competition has tightened margins across the sector.
Analyst commentary collected by MarketBeat shows a predominantly Hold to Sell stance on WBA, with target prices clustered around the low-to-mid-teens, reflecting cautious sentiment toward the traditional brick-and-mortar drugstore model.
The product behind the stock
Walgreens Boots Alliance makes most of its revenue from its retail pharmacy chain, including prescription dispensing, over-the-counter medicines, beauty products and basic household goods in thousands of Walgreens and Boots stores as well as through digital channels.
